The Importance of Effective Leadership in Business

Leadership plays a critical role in shaping an organization’s vision, culture, and overall performance. A capable leader provides direction, motivates employees, and ensures that business objectives align with the company’s mission. Some key benefits of effective leadership include:

  • Enhanced Productivity – Strong leaders inspire their teams to work efficiently and productively.
  • Improved Employee Engagement – Good leadership fosters a positive work environment where employees feel valued and motivated.
  • Better Decision-Making – Leaders with strong analytical and strategic skills can make informed decisions that drive business growth.
  • Adaptability and Innovation – Effective leadership encourages innovation and adaptability in an ever-changing business landscape.

Essential Leadership Skills for Business Success

1. Vision and Strategic Thinking

A successful leader must have a clear vision and the ability to strategize effectively. Visionary leaders set long-term goals and develop strategic plans to achieve them. To cultivate this skill:

  • Define a compelling vision for the organization.
  • Set SMART (Specific, Measurable, Achievable, Relevant, and Time-bound) goals.
  • Continuously evaluate and adjust strategies to meet changing market conditions.

2. Communication Skills

Clear and effective communication is essential for leadership. Leaders must articulate their vision, expectations, and feedback to their teams efficiently. Key aspects of strong communication include:

  • Active listening to understand employee concerns and suggestions.
  • Providing constructive feedback to encourage growth and improvement.
  • Utilizing multiple communication channels, including meetings, emails, and one-on-one conversations.

3. Emotional Intelligence (EQ)

Emotional intelligence is the ability to recognize, understand, and manage emotions in oneself and others. High EQ enables leaders to:

  • Build strong interpersonal relationships.
  • Manage stress and conflicts effectively.
  • Motivate and inspire their team members.

4. Decision-Making and Problem-Solving

Leaders often face complex challenges that require quick and effective decision-making. To improve this skill:

  • Gather relevant data and analyze different perspectives.
  • Consider potential risks and outcomes before making decisions.
  • Develop problem-solving frameworks to address issues systematically.

5. Adaptability and Flexibility

The business world is constantly evolving, and leaders must be adaptable to stay ahead. Adaptability involves:

  • Embracing change and new technologies.
  • Being open to feedback and continuous learning.
  • Encouraging a culture of innovation within the organization.

6. Delegation and Empowerment

Effective leaders understand that they cannot do everything alone. Delegation helps in optimizing productivity and empowering employees. Best practices for delegation include:

  • Assigning tasks based on employees’ strengths and expertise.
  • Trusting employees to complete their work without micromanaging.
  • Providing necessary support and resources to ensure success.

7. Conflict Resolution Skills

Workplace conflicts are inevitable, but strong leaders know how to resolve them efficiently. To improve conflict resolution skills:

  • Address conflicts early before they escalate.
  • Encourage open dialogue and active listening.
  • Find mutually beneficial solutions that align with organizational goals.

8. Integrity and Ethical Leadership

Integrity is the foundation of trustworthy leadership. Ethical leaders gain respect and loyalty from their teams. Essential practices include:

  • Leading by example with honesty and transparency.
  • Upholding ethical business practices and standards.
  • Creating a culture of accountability and responsibility.

9. Inspirational and Motivational Skills

A great leader inspires and motivates employees to achieve their best. To become a motivational leader:

  • Recognize and reward employee achievements.
  • Foster a positive and inclusive workplace culture.
  • Provide opportunities for professional growth and development.

10. Resilience and Stress Management

Business leadership comes with challenges and setbacks. Resilient leaders can navigate difficult times effectively. Ways to build resilience include:

  • Maintaining a positive mindset during adversity.
  • Developing stress management techniques such as mindfulness and exercise.
  • Learning from failures and using them as opportunities for growth.

How to Develop Effective Leadership Skills

Continuous Learning and Development

  • Attend leadership training programs and workshops.
  • Read books, articles, and case studies on leadership.
  • Seek mentorship from experienced leaders.

Practice Self-Awareness

  • Reflect on personal strengths and weaknesses.
  • Request feedback from peers and employees.
  • Work on areas that need improvement.

Build Strong Relationships

  • Foster open communication with team members.
  • Encourage teamwork and collaboration.
  • Develop a supportive and inclusive work environment.

Lead by Example

  • Demonstrate commitment, dedication, and professionalism.
  • Exhibit strong work ethics and accountability.
  • Be a role model for employees.
